Air resistance opposes the bullet's motion, reducing its acceleration and eventually causing it to reach a terminal velocity. For bullets, this terminal velocity is commonly around 150 miles-per-hour, however, in some circumstances, this can still be lethal. https://bigthink.com/starts-with-a-bang/the-science-of-why-firing-your-gun-up-into-the-air-can-be-lethal/
